Korea Ranks Second in Worldwide Semiconductor Device Market Share in 2013
January 22, 2014

Korea's Ministry of Trade, Industry and Energy announced that the country overtook Japan in IC sales last year to become the second largest semiconductor device supplier in the world, following the United States, due to the growth in market share of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ix, according to Korea IT News on January 21. The global semiconductor device market in 2013 amounted to US$317.9 billion, of which Korean vendors grabbed around US$50.1 billion, or 15.8% of the market. Japan made US$44.3 billion, which is translated into 13.9% market share. The major items leading to Korea's advancement were memory semiconductors, such as DRAM (Dynamic Random Access Memory) and NAND flash.
